Abstract(in English) PCI-Express Adaptive Communication Hub 2 (PEACH2) is ultra-low latency high bandwidth switch for connecting multiple nodes of heterogeneous cluster by using the PCIe directly. PEACH2 is implemented on Altera's Stratix IV, a large-scale FPGA, and its extra logic can be used to implement hardware computational modules for further acceleration. In this paper, we implemented computational modules on PEACH2, and evaluated with a simple reduction module attached to Avalon-MM bus. Execution time of reduction of GPU data with the computational module in PEACH2 was compared with the case when the host CPU was used. As a result, when the data size is small, reduction in PEACH2 acheived up to 45 times performance improvement.
